It was at (low) platinum, and I agree I was very surprised, it doesn't really feel like the deck should have been able to hang.

I think the shadow urchins felt good, though it is tricky managing the -1/-1s if you dont currently have a disposable target. Typically I had a token lying around though from Brigid or Scarblade's Malice. they also played very well when an opponent's main form of removal was -1/-1 counters. Multiple times people blight rotted something on my board and gave me 4 cards.

I think I do get where you're coming from in that you believe the edit wasn't changing the content of his speech. But, I do think we can't really get around the fact the edit's goal was to create a specific moment that didn't exist, which was an act of deceit.

To use an analogy, when I was a kid there was a derren brown special where among other things he flipped 10 heads in a row. Then the big "reveal" was he actually flipped the coin 1000's of times, and just cut it so it only showed his run of 10 heads. The out of context clip didn't really "misrepresent" what happened, he did flip 10 heads in a row, but it was still dishonest.

As you say, Trump's full speech is damning as hell, and he did incite a riot, which just makes the fact they did this all the more exhausting.
